1. requests Channel Data Transfer with One Repetition can Exhaust TCP Connections Because tearing down a TCP connection is time consuming it is possible that programming your ladder in a certain way can quickly exhaust all available TCP connections This can be avoided by programming your COMMREQs in a slightly different way Your ladder can benefit from the reprogramming if m The number of repetitions word 9 in an Establish Read Channel or Establish Write Channel COMMREQ is set to one 1 and a new COMMREOQ is issued immediately upon completion of the prior one m Each successive COMMREQ is directed to the same target device same IP address m Each successive COMMREO is directed to the same channel number To avoid TCP connection exhaustion you should set the number of repetitions COMMREQ word 9 to two 2 and set the read write period COMMREQ words 10 Important Product Information Factory LAN TCP IP Ethernet Interface Type 2 GFK 1314E October 1 1997 and 11 to be very large such as 60 seconds With these parameters you can issue the first COMMREQ wait for the COMMREQ Status CRS word to turn to one 1 then issue the next COMMREQ wait for the CRS word to turn to one etc and there will not be TCP connection exhaustion problems Interrupting an active channel allows the reuse of an existing TCP connection while a repetition count of one starts the time consuming TCP connection teardown immediately upon complet

October 1 1997 GFK 1314E IMPORTANT PRODUCT INFORMATION READ THIS INFORMATION FIRST Product Factory LAN TCP IP Ethernet Interface Type 2 IC697CMM742 FD Firmware Version 2 00 This is release 2 00 of the IC697 Ethernet Interface Module Type 2 This module provides network communications using SRTP Service Request Transfer Protocol over standardTCP IP Transmission Control Protocol and Internet Protocol on an Ethernet LAN Local Area Network The Ethernet Interface supports communications between 1C697 PLCs and or IC693 PLCs equipped with TCP IP Ethernet Interfaces The Ethernet Interface can also communicate with IC641 TCP IP Ethernet programming software and applications which use the TCP IP Host Communication Toolkit software Additional features and benefits for this module include m Higher performance compared to IC697CMM 741 2 to 4 times higher throughput for data transfers between PLCs with identical Channel setups m 32 simultaneous network connections twice the number supported by IC697CMM 741 m Configuration of Ethernet Interface fully supported within CPU configuration Centralized IP network configuration management is also supported via standard BOOTP protocol m Addressability to other IC697CMM742 Interfaces using DDP names standard DNS Domain Name Service names or IP addresses m Three alternate Ethernet network ports are available on the IC697CMM742 Interface Two of the network ports the 10BaseT twis

9. e AUI network port is used the IC697CMM742 Interface requires that the SQE test be enabled on the external transceiver connecting it to the Ethernet LAN Make sure your transceiver has SQE enabled PLC Power Supply Requirements If the AUI network port is used the IC697CMM742 Interface requires that the PLC include a power supply which supplies 12Vdc IC697PWR711 721 724 731 or 748 6 Important Product Information Factory LAN TCP IP Ethernet Interface Type 2 October 1 1997 GFK 1314E Restrictions and Significant Open Problems Open Problems in Release 2 00 Firmware This section describes known limitations in the current firmware Release 2 00 ID Code Description 54556 The IC697CMM 742 Interface can not communicate with the local PLC CPU when a PLC load or a store operation is in progress A PLC load or store operation via IC641 software WSL Serial and orEthernet has priority over all other communications During a PLC load or store operation it is possible for channels or server connections to experience time out errors which may lead to disconnections Possible ara Se logentriesinclude8 8 8 38 and 8 40 Whenever thesebackplaneerrors are logged there are likely to also be additional exception logs for terminated TCP connec tions and SRTP Server and Channel API errors 60873 Log Eventc entry 2 10f has been witnessed during extremely heavy traffic conditions on the Local Area Network A potential workaround is to i

13. h network bandwidth utilization by the IC697CMM742 Interface can cause higher than normal rate of network collisions which may cause timeouts on data transfers If your application requires many simultaneous network connections between IC697CMM742 Interfaces it is recommended that the minimum interval between host accesses read period and write period used in COMMREQs be set to the required rate for your particular application instead of as fast as possible so the network does not become overloaded with network traffic to and from the IC697CMM 742 Interface CPU Performance Limitation Again due to its performance potential the IC697CMM 742 Interface can present a heavy load on the CPU at its maximum operating capacity It is strongly recommended that caution be taken when using multiple connections operating in an as fast as possible mode especially when a model 781 or 782 CPU is used The COMMREQ Status Word CRS Word may occasionally become FE07 or FE87 which means service requests are made to the CPU faster than the CPU can process them Although communications will proceed to the next repetition even when this is encountered data transfer for the current repetition of this connection would have failed to complete n u To avoid this situation configure the minimum interval between host accesses read period or writeperiod to a larger value so the CPU has enough time to process all service

15. mpting recovery This release of firmware will now attempt recovery immediately and then once a second for the first 10 seconds then once every 10 seconds as before Increased Queue Sizes Due to available memory on the IC697CMM 742 various queue sizes have been increased to avoid potential network packet discards These include the LLC receive ring increased from 64 to 128 and the IP layer input queue increased from 64 to 128 and the IP layer output queue increased from 33 to 128 Enhanced Problem Debugging Tools Various enhancements have been made in this release of firmware to provide better debugging tools They include Additional Information in Fault Logging for Event 12 entry 2 10 1C TCP Log events Event 12 that recorded the taking down of a TCP connection did not identify the remote host that was connected This information can be useful for system troubleshooting and was often impossible to get after the connection came down TCP log events entry 2 10 through 1c have now been updated to show the IP address of the remote node in entries 3 and 4 New Station Manager Command killss The new killss station manager command has been added in this release of the IC697CMM742 TCP IP firmware The killss command is used to terminate established SRTP Server endpoints This command is intended for maintenance and diagnostic purposes only The syntax for the command is as follows killss all lt SRTP Serve

21. r endpoint gt lt SRIP Server endpoint gt killss all causes all established SRTP Server endpoints to be terminated If the endpoint numbers as shown in the output of stat v command are specified only those endpoints would be terminated This command will not terminate any endpoints which are not in ESTABLISHED state The killss command is a modify command therefore the user is required to be logged in before using this command Enhanced Station Manager Output for statv To help in debugging a PLC setup the number of received requests and the IP address of the client for every SRTP Server endpoint have been added to the display in response to stat v station manager command 4 Important Product Information Factory LAN TCP IP Ethernet Interface Type 2 October 1 1997 GFK 1314E Operational Notes Network Bandwidth Utilization Due to its performance potential the IC697CMM 742 Interface can present a heavy load on the network segment at its maximum operating capacity It is strongly recommended that caution be taken when using multiple connections operating in an as fast as possible mode Tests conducted showed that 32 simultaneous Channels transferring 2 Kilobytes of data per Channel between two IC697CMM742 Interfaces can use up as much as 18 of the total network bandwidth when the Channels are all configured to run as fast as possible using 91x or 92x CPUs The potentially hig
